site stats

Change schema of dataframe pyspark

WebMar 28, 2024 · Since the function pyspark.sql.DataFrameWriter.insertInto, which inserts the content of the DataFrame to the specified table, requires that the schema of the class:DataFrame is the same as the schema of … WebSep 24, 2024 · Pretty than automatically adding the new columns, Delta Lake enforces the schema and stops the write from occurring. Go help identify which column(s) caused the mismatch, Spark prints out twain plans in aforementioned stack trace for comparison. How to Change Column Type in PySpark Dataframe ? - GeeksforGeeks. Whereby Is …

Schema Evolution & Enforcement on Delta Lake - Databricks

WebMay 19, 2024 · The DataFrame consists of 16 features or columns. Each column contains string-type values. Let’s get started with the functions: select(): The select function helps us to display a subset of selected columns from the entire dataframe we just need to pass the desired column names. Let’s print any three columns of the dataframe using select(). WebFeb 7, 2024 · PySpark StructType & StructField classes are used to programmatically specify the schema to the DataFrame and create complex columns like nested struct, … showmecpr https://lezakportraits.com

PySpark StructType & StructField Explained with Examples

WebALTER TABLE SET command can also be used for changing the file location and file format for existing tables. If the table is cached, the ALTER TABLE .. SET LOCATION command clears cached data of the table and all its dependents that refer to it. The cache will be lazily filled when the next time the table or the dependents are accessed. WebSpark Schema defines the structure of the DataFrame which you can get by calling printSchema() method on the DataFrame object. Spark SQL provides StructType & StructField classes to programmatically specify the schema.. By default, Spark infers the schema from the data, however, sometimes we may need to define our own schema … WebIn this case, it inferred the schema from the data itself. You can, however, specify your own schema for a dataframe. Construct Schema for a DataFrame. You can construct … showmecrimes

Schema Evolution & Enforcement on Delta Lake - Databricks / …

Category:A Beginners Guide to Spark DataFrame Schema - Analytics Vidhya

Tags:Change schema of dataframe pyspark

Change schema of dataframe pyspark

A Beginners Guide to Spark DataFrame Schema - Analytics Vidhya

WebJul 11, 2024 · For Spark in Batch mode, one way to change column nullability is by creating a new dataframe with a new schema that has the desired nullability. val schema = dataframe.schema // modify [ [StructField] with name `cn` val newSchema = StructType (schema.map { case StructField ( c, t, _, m) if c.equals (cn) => StructField ( c, t, nullable ... Web15 hours ago · let's say I have a dataframe with the below schema. How can I dynamically traverse schema and access the nested fields in an array field or struct field and modify the value using withField().The withField() doesn't seem to work with array fields and is always expecting a struct. I am trying to figure out a dynamic way to do this as long as I know …

Change schema of dataframe pyspark

Did you know?

WebApache Spark DataFrames provide a rich set of functions (select columns, filter, join, aggregate) that allow you to solve common data analysis problems efficiently. Apache … Web1 day ago · I am trying to create a pysaprk dataframe manually. But data is not getting inserted in the dataframe. the code is as follow : `from pyspark import SparkContext from pyspark.sql import SparkSession...

WebHow to Change Schema of a Spark SQL. I am new to Spark and just started an online pyspark tutorial. I uploaded the json data in DataBrick and wrote the commands as follows: df = sqlContext.sql ("SELECT * FROM people_json") df.printSchema () from pyspark.sql.types import *. Web10 hours ago · How to change dataframe column names in PySpark? 1 PySpark: TypeError: StructType can not accept object in type or

WebFeb 9, 2024 · Method 1: typing values in Python to create Pandas DataFrame. Note that you don’t need to use quotes around numeric values (unless you wish to capture those values as strings. Method 2: importing values from an Excel file to create Pandas DataFrame. Get the maximum value from the DataFrame. WebOct 24, 2024 · Actually, you will see below that the Delta schema didn’t change and the number of columns stayed as is. The file is overwritten with the 100,000 records from the events_delta data frame and ...

WebJan 23,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

WebSep 24, 2024 · Pretty than automatically adding the new columns, Delta Lake enforces the schema and stops the write from occurring. Go help identify which column(s) caused the … showmecu.orgWebJun 26, 2024 · Spark infers the types based on the row values when you don’t explicitly provides types. Use the schema attribute to fetch the actual schema object associated with a DataFrame. df.schema. StructType(List(StructField(num,LongType,true),StructField(letter,StringType,true))) The … showmed addressWebArray data type. Binary (byte array) data type. Boolean data type. Base class for data types. Date (datetime.date) data type. Decimal (decimal.Decimal) data type. Double data type, representing double precision floats. Float data type, … showmed boltonWebFeb 9, 2024 · Method 1: typing values in Python to create Pandas DataFrame. Note that you don’t need to use quotes around numeric values (unless you wish to capture those … showmed staff portalWebJan 24, 2024 · If you wanted to change the schema (column name & data type) while converting pandas to PySpark DataFrame, create a PySpark Schema using StructType and use it for the schema. from pyspark.sql.types import StructType,StructField, StringType, IntegerType #Create User defined Custom Schema using StructType … showmediadialogWebHow to Change Schema of a Spark SQL. I am new to Spark and just started an online pyspark tutorial. I uploaded the json data in DataBrick and wrote the commands as … showmed.portalWebMar 16, 2024 · I have an use case where I read data from a table and parse a string column into another one with from_json() by specifying the schema: from pyspark.sql.functions import from_json, col spark = SparkSession.builder.appName("FromJsonExample").getOrCreate() input_df = … showmed sywell